With all respect, not talking about the "ballance" of the paddle is a bad sign.
I have bought many paddles because of the reviews.. Many of them turned out to be head heavy! And to me (coming to the game from tennis and the pro Staff), this is a no go!
Every serious tennis racket reviewer will talk about the ballance.
I hope pickleball reviewers will catch on...
Reviewers have started charting out balance (I measure it whenever I get a paddle).
However, I haven't found a clear correlation yet in PB about which range feels head light, head heavy, and balanced.
If I can't articulate it well, I don't want to say a number with no meaning attached to it.
@@PickleballStudio Thanks for your answer! I see. So there is not yet a convention in pickleball.
But maybe just state that it is head heavy or head light or we'll balanced. This is something that you can "feel". That would be good enough 👌

This from the guy who says Kevlar is a "gimmick" 🧐
No, I said it was being used as a buzzword.
I further clarified in that review that the claims they were making were not proven yet. Such as longer lasting spin or better spin and a stronger surface material. So far, that has been accurate.
It doesn't seem to last any longer than raw carbon fiber, and spin in some cases is higher, but still hasn't exceeded the highest RCF spin rate.
The difference in terms of spin rate between kevlar and RCF likely comes down to how gritty it came from the factory. The consistency rate of peel ply surfaces is terrible in this industry.
What I will say I was wrong about though, is that kevlar has clearly proven to be something the market likes and plays very solid.
@@PickleballStudioKevlar has great spin, unknown durability, but the real advantage seems to be soft plush feel while retaining above average power and pop.
